how to book

To book an appointment with an artist at Red Clover Tattoo Collective you’ll first need to choose which artist you’d like to work with. To do this, we recommend checking out each artist’s portfolio! You can find each artist’s work through the shop's Instagram, @redclovertattoocollective where all the artists’ pages are tagged in the bio or you can find all artists’ profile under the artist tab on our website.


Once you decide on an artist, check to see if their books are open or what date they’re opening next, if their books are closed that means they are not taking on new appointments. Each artist has their own booking process and we encourage you to check their individual pages for the most up to date information. Most often artists use a google form which is linked and available on their Instagram and/or web page -only- when their books are open. Each artist opens their books every couple of months and will post dates and how-to steps in advance on their personal Instagram as well as the shop Instagram.


Because Red Clover is not a walk-in shop, all our artists are by appointment only. If their books are closed this means they are not accepting new appointments so please be patient and wait for the artist to announce their book opening dates. Messaging or emailing the shop or artist directly is not how to book. 


Sometimes artists have last-minute openings in their schedule, in this case the artist will make a post on their personal instagram with specifications on how to claim the time slot and what project(s) they’re looking to do.
